What's career growth & development like at Neostella?

Strengths in internal movement, a stated growth ethos, and accessible learning materials are accompanied by unclear advancement frameworks, client-driven time pressures on formal learning, and evidence of external hiring for senior roles. Together, these dynamics suggest real opportunities to grow exist alongside variability in promotion pathways and learning time that likely depends on team and role.

Key Insight for Candidates

Tradeoff: Neostella pairs genuine growth signals and some internal promotions with frequent external hiring for senior posts and no formal internal-mobility policy. Result: advancement is possible but timing and paths are less predictable, and internal candidates may compete directly with external talent for step-up roles.

Positive Themes About Neostella

  • Internal Mobility: A company press release on Oct 22, 2025 explicitly cites an internal promotion to Chief People Officer, demonstrating upward movement from within.
  • Growth Culture: Company materials highlight “Growth” among core principles and describe Neostella as “a place where people can grow,” signaling a pro-development ethos.
  • Training & Education Access: Published product learning modules and a maintained knowledge center, alongside references to training and certifications in partner-facing content, indicate accessible learning resources.

Considerations About Neostella

  • Unclear Advancement: Public-facing pages do not describe a formal promote-from-within policy or publish promotion rates, leaving advancement consistency unspecified.
  • Insufficient Resources: As a services and product company with client-driven workloads, time for formal learning is noted as compressed even when certifications are encouraged.
  • Limited Mobility: The Oct 22, 2025 leadership announcement also lists senior roles filled by external hires, showing top posts are sometimes sourced outside the company.
